Using pirated tools in a professional environment can ruin a business or career. If you share a CATIA file generated with a cracked license, the file often carries "pirated" or "unlicensed" metadata tags. When sent to a client or supplier using legitimate software, their system will flag your file, instantly exposing your unauthorized usage.
